Output db0b89f60e3045d0b2b537c5b816ccaf040816aeb22f3a36f5155ccb7cee4f66:30

value
2259196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f73b4ccb66a86819d9f744829fab31db4b262a OP_EQUAL
address
3AzALsevvSsJfERKXxGh8z1weh2dYCDFpF
transaction
db0b89f60e3045d0b2b537c5b816ccaf040816aeb22f3a36f5155ccb7cee4f66
spent
true